admonition的意思

admonition


英式读音
英式读音

  • n.警告;告诫
  • 网络训诫;劝告;训词

近义词

    n.caution,warning,reprimand,rebuke,reproach

反义词

    n.approval

英汉释义

  • n.

    1.训诫,忠告

    2.温和的责备

英英释义

  • n.

    1.a warning about someone’s behavior

英汉例句

  • 1.I felt perplexed: I didn't know whether it were not a proper opportunity to offer a bit of admonition.

    我觉得很惶惑。我不知道现在是不是奉献忠告的合适机会。

  • 2.You want someone to keep in mind his mother's admonition about not jumping off the Brooklyn Bridge just because all of his friends do.

    当所有人都在跳下布鲁克林大桥的时候,你要让一个人牢记妈妈的警告,让他不要跳。

  • 3.He wrote, "Fathers, do not provoke your children to wrath, but bring them up in the training and admonition of the Lord" (Eph. 6: 4).

    他写道:「你们作父亲的,不要惹儿女的气,只要照著主的教训和警戒养育他们」(以弗所书6章4节)。

  • 4.The book, he said in his commencement address at Stanford in 2005, ends with the admonition "Stay Hungry. Stay Foolish. "

    他在2005年斯坦福大学的毕业典礼上讲到,那本书以这句话结尾,“求知若渴,虚怀若愚”。

  • 5.Mr Wen's most severe admonition for out-of-line officials was to make a provincial governor write a self-criticism.

    而温家宝迄今对不听话官员所发出的最严厉警告,只是让一名省长写了一份检查。

  • 6.And, ye fathers, provoke not your children to wrath: but bring them up in the nurture and admonition of the Lord.

    你们作父亲的,不要惹儿女的气,只要照着主的教训和警戒,养育他们。

  • 7.From the point of view of history development, the efforts in admonition reflected a factor that the bachelor politics was winding up.

    从历史的发展来看,明代官员在进谏方面的努力,可视为中国古代士人政治的挽歌。

  • 8.And fathers , do not provoke your children to anger , but nurture them in the discipline and admonition of the Lord .

    弗六4作父亲的,不要惹你们儿女的气,只要用主的管教和警戒养育他们。

  • 9.Red wine tends to have a higher iron content, hence the admonition against mixing it with seafood.

    红酒往往铁含量较高,因此警告大家吃海味时不要喝红酒。

  • 10.Ye Er'an's Admonition was a collection of family letters, which were written by him from 1873 to 1876 when he worked in Henan.

    《叶贞甫先生家训》系尔安于1873至1876年在河南游幕游宦时所写的家书集。
